Inside the Glass: Ingredients & Their Role
- Fruit juices: Bright and tart, they form the mocktailโs lively coreโuse fresh for the best punch.
- Sparkling water: Adds effervescence, keeps the drink light and refreshingโchoose plain or flavored for variety.
- Citrus (lemon/lime/orange): Brings zing and aromaโsqueeze fresh for that oozy, smoky burst.
- Herbs or edible flowers: Optional but beautifulโmint, basil, or violets add a fragrant, colorful touch.
- Sweetener (honey or agave): Just a touch balances acidityโgo for a mild, neutral flavor to avoid overpowering.

Crafting Your Festive Sparkle: Step-by-Step
Step 1: Start by gathering your favorite fruit juicesโthink pomegranate, cranberry, and orange. They form the bright, tart base.
Step 2: Fill a shaker with ice, about halfway. Pour in 120 ml of your chosen juice, plus a splash of sparkling water for fizz.
Step 3: Add a squeeze of fresh lemon or lime to brighten everything up. Shake gentlyโjust enough to chill and mix.
Step 4: Strain into glasses rimmed with sugar or salt, then top with a little more sparkling water for that lively sparkle.
Tips & Tricks for the Perfect Holiday Mocktail
- Ensure juices are well chilled before mixing, for a refreshing sip.
- Donโt over-shakeโgentle agitation keeps the fizz lively and prevents dilution.
- Taste as you goโadjust sweetness with a touch of honey or a splash of more citrus.
- Use fresh citrus for garnishes to add that extra zing and aroma.
Common Pitfalls & How to Fix Them
- Over-shaking, losing fizz.? Too flatโAdd a splash more sparkling water or soda.
- Oversweetened juice.? Too sweetโDilute with extra citrus or a splash of plain water.
- Using old or bland juice.? Weak flavorโUse fresh citrus and high-quality juice.
- Rimming glasses improperly.? Clumpy salt or sugar on rimsโMoisten rims with citrus and sprinkle immediately.

Method
- Gather your chilled fruit juices and measure out about 120 ml into your cocktail shaker.

- Add a splash of sparkling water to the shaker, about 30 ml, to start building the fizz.

- Squeeze a fresh lemon or lime wedge into the shaker to add zesty brightness, then drop the wedge in.

- Add a teaspoon or two of honey or agave syrup for a touch of sweetness and balance.

- Fill the shaker halfway with ice, then secure the lid and shake gently for about 10 seconds until the mixture is well chilled and slightly bubbly.

- Place a fine strainer over a glass, then strain the mixture into it to remove pulp and ice shards, ensuring a clear, fizzy drink.

- Top off the glass with more sparkling water for extra effervescence and a lively sparkle.
- Garnish with fresh herbs or edible flowers on top for a colorful, fragrant finishing touch.
- Repeat these steps for each glass, adjusting sweetness and citrus to your taste as needed.
- Serve immediately and enjoy the bubbly, vibrant refreshment thatโs perfect for any celebration!
